'Hollyoaks' Anna Shaffer talks Ruby, Jono and Esther - interview

Hollyoaks sixth former Ruby Button has busy times ahead on screen in the coming days as the build-up to her upcoming wedding storyline begins.

When Ruby reunites with fellow student Martin 'Jono' Johnson (Dylan Llewellyn) next week, their reignited relationship develops quickly - culminating in a surprise proposal.

As well as the romance plot, Ruby continues to be a key player in the soap's ongoing teen bullying storyline, failing to support Esther Bloom (Jazmine Franks) as her ordeal gets worse.

Digital Spy recently caught up with Anna Shaffer, who plays Ruby, to hear her thoughts on the latest dramas for her character.

'Hollyoaks' Kieron Richardson talks Ste rage, love plots

http://i2.cdnds.net/12/18/M/soaps_hollyoaks_kieron_richardson.jpg

Hollyoaks has a big week lined up for Ste Hay as his mother Pauline makes a surprise return to the village, sending him into turmoil.

Thrown by Pauline's arrival and the fact that his boyfriend Doug Carter (PJ Brennan) invited her, Ste finds his bad temper returning and ends up trashing the deli in a rage - only for ex-lover Brendan Brady (Emmett Scanlan) to unexpectedly come to the rescue.

Digital Spy recently caught up with Kieron Richardson, who plays Ste, to hear about this week's storyline and the latest on the 'Stendan' and 'Stug' love triangle.

How does Pauline's return to the village come about?
"In the build-up to Pauline coming back, Ste is feeling quite low as he thinks that he hasn't really got any friends. There's been a memorial for Riley with a lot of lad banter, which Ste can't join in with. He ends up feeling quite isolated and he turns to drink after that. Ste is just a bit depressed in general, because he doesn't have family he can rely on like Doug does, and Amy has left now too.

"Doug's answer to all of this is to ring up Ste's mum, as he thinks Ste must be missing his family. Doug isn't really aware of the past between Ste and Pauline so he thinks he's doing a good thing, when in actual fact he's opening a big can of worms that Ste thought he'd got rid of.

"When Pauline turns up, it's a complete shock to Ste because they've had no contact at all in the past three years. But all of a sudden, she's there on the doorstep!"

For the benefit of newer viewers, can you remind us of Ste's relationship with his mum?
"What regular viewers will know is that Ste was brought up in an abusive background, with his stepdad beating him up. His mum was an alcoholic, so he's never really had any loving family whatsoever. That explains why he went off the rails, stole cars and beat up Amy - he'd only ever known abuse in his life.

"The last scenes we saw with Pauline involved her stealing money from Il Gnosh, where Ste used to work with Tony. Her parting words were that she wished Ste had never been born, so there's certainly no love lost between them!

"They haven't spoke at all since then, so Pauline doesn't know about Ste's sexuality, she's never met baby Lucas, she doesn't know about Brendan and she definitely doesn't know about Doug. She's got a lot to find out about!"

James Sutton's Hollyoaks return storyline 'has never been done before'

James Sutton's comeback storyline in Hollyoaks has "never been used in a soap", according to friend Pete Price.

Sutton's legendary character John Paul will return to the village before the end of the year, but the plot remains a secret.

http://i2.cdnds.net/10/06/soaps_emmerdale_james_sutton_0.jpg

Price, also a well-known local radio presenter, told the Liverpool Echo: "The role as John Paul is gritty, emotional, sympathetic, controversial with lots of snogging.

"The storyline that he is coming back with has never been used in a soap."

Price also confirmed the exact timing of Sutton's reprisal of his troubled character, adding that John Paul will be "back on screen just before Christmas".

John Paul fled the village after his half brother Niall killed his half sister during a church explosion.

James Sutton, whose return to Hollyoaks after four years was announced last month, starred as Emmerdale's Ryan Lamb between 2009 and 2011.

'Hollyoaks' PJ Brennan talks wedding day disaster

Hollyoaks' Doug Carter is involved in some of the soap's biggest scenes ever next week as disaster strikes on the day of his wedding to Ste Hay.

Doug and Ste are sharing a joint ceremony with Tony Hutchinson and Cindy Longford, but all four characters and their guests face terrible danger when the sixth formers plough through the venue in an out-of-control mini-bus, causing a pillar to collapse and the roof to cave in.

Digital Spy recently caught up with PJ Brennan, who plays Doug, to hear about his character's role in the dramatic episodes.

How have you found being involved in this huge storyline?
"It's been fantastic. For Doug, this has been building up since March when his storyline with Ste began, and this is a culmination of everything we've been doing. There's been a steady build-up to this moment and it's been great.

"Filming the episodes was hard work and the location shoots were very long hours, because we had some terrible weather to deal with. But we all fought through it with a good attitude and it's been really satisfying to film. I've already seen little clips and I think it's going to be really, really good to watch. I was gasping and I know what happens!"

What was your first reaction when you found out about the crash?
"It's a really dramatic storyline, so I think all of us were very, very excited. It can be tricky, because although you try to be objective about the storylines, I'm probably someone who is very concerned about my character's welfare - I forget that he's fake!

"I was a bit nervous for that reason, but once we got the specifics, I could see that it was very solid material. I think it's a really good reflection of the direction that we're going in at Hollyoaks. We're going back to the show's soap roots and doing some big, bombastic storylines."

How long did it take to film the episodes?
"In terms of being on-location, it was a full week. I wasn't there every day, but they devoted two days to the actual stunts. It was 8am to 8pm every day and it was a full, solid week of being on location for the cast and crew."

Is Doug one of the characters in danger when the crash happens?
"He's definitely in danger! Anyone who is at the wedding is in danger considering that a bus ploughs through the venue, so he's certainly at risk. It also comes at the worst time possible, because there's a gigantic reveal between Ste and Doug just before the crash occurs. At that point, the secret is revealed that Doug has gone behind Ste's back to take out Brendan…"

When it comes to the big scenes, how much is genuine and how much is special effects?
"Well, they got a really good team of stunt doubles in, and we spent a few hours just watching them do their work. Obviously they're professionals and they're fantastic, so a lot of the human involvement in the accident is genuine. I know that there were a couple of injuries, so ask those stunt doubles and they'll tell you it was definitely human involvement!

"We did see the actual crash itself, and I think it looks fantastic given that it's a mix of real-life people and CGI effects. I don't think you can really tell when it comes to the special effects. It's a perfect blend. Hollyoaks have invested a lot of money and time into this storyline, and I think it's paid off."

'Hollyoaks' achieves best-rated Friday first look in two months

E4 managed its best Friday first-look ratings for Hollyoaks in over two months on November 9.

Maddie's attempt to kiss Jono ahead of his wedding to Ruby was seen by 554,000 - a 2.6% share - on the digital channel.

Channel 4's normal edition, which focused on the lead-up to Tony and Cindy's wedding, logged 964k (4.8%) at 6.30pm.
